The Gremlins Collection

The "Gremlins Collection" is a cherished duo of films that have carved out a unique niche in the landscape of 1980s and 1990s cinema, blending horror, comedy, and a touch of the holiday spirit. The collection comprises the original "Gremlins," released in 1984, and its sequel, "Gremlins 2: The New Batch," which followed six years later in 1990. Directed by Joe Dante and with Steven Spielberg serving as executive producer, the first film was a critical and commercial success, captivating audiences with its inventive storytelling and darkly humorous tone. Written by Chris Columbus, "Gremlins" introduced the world to the enigmatic and adorable Mogwai named Gizmo, whose peculiar care instructions inadvertently lead to the hatching of a band of mischievous creatures. These creatures, once exposed to water or fed after midnight, undergo a metamorphosis into the titular gremlins—small, destructive, and malevolent monsters that wreak havoc on a small town during the Christmas season.

The sequel, "Gremlins 2: The New Batch," takes the audience on a new adventure, this time in the heart of New York City. While the original film juxtaposed its black comedy against the backdrop of Christmas, the second installment leans into the absurdity and humor of the situation, offering a more lighthearted and satirical take on its predecessor. The gremlins invade a high-tech skyscraper, leading to a series of outlandish and comedic scenarios. Despite the shift in tone, "Gremlins 2" maintains the spirit of the original, with the return of beloved characters and the introduction of new, memorable gremlins, each with their own distinct personalities. The film also delves deeper into the lore of the Mogwai and gremlins, expanding the universe and answering some of the questions left by the first film.
